如何在TYPO3 7.6中将ts配置转换为全新的扩展

如何在TYPO3 7.6中将ts配置转换为全新的扩展,typo3,typoscript,typo3-7.6.x,Typo3,Typoscript,Typo3 7.6.x,我按照官方指南在TYPO3 7.6上创建了一个新的扩展,它基于一个旧的扩展,需要静态配置和模板中的配置,但在controller中,我无法获得配置 $this->settings 返回一个空数组 $GLOBALS['TYPO3_CONF_VARS']['EXT']['extConf'][strtolower($this->extensionName)] $TYPO3_LOADED_EXT[strtolower($this->extensionName)] 返回一个空数组

我按照官方指南在TYPO3 7.6上创建了一个新的扩展,它基于一个旧的扩展,需要静态配置和模板中的配置,但在controller中,我无法获得配置

$this->settings 
返回一个空数组

$GLOBALS['TYPO3_CONF_VARS']['EXT']['extConf'][strtolower($this->extensionName)]
$TYPO3_LOADED_EXT[strtolower($this->extensionName)]
返回一个空数组

$GLOBALS['TYPO3_CONF_VARS']['EXT']['extConf'][strtolower($this->extensionName)]
$TYPO3_LOADED_EXT[strtolower($this->extensionName)]
返回一个空数组

$GLOBALS['TYPO3_CONF_VARS']['EXT']['extConf'][strtolower($this->extensionName)]
$TYPO3_LOADED_EXT[strtolower($this->extensionName)]
有人知道如何操作TYPO3 7.6中的配置吗


感谢您的客户分机
setup.ts
constant.ts
这样的帮助

$this->settings['enableWebsiteField']
setup.ts

plugin.tx_yourextension_key {   
    settings {
        enableWebsiteField = {$plugin.tx_extension_key.settings.enableWebsiteField}
}
 plugin.tx_yourextension_key {  
       settings {
        enableWebsiteField = 1
 }
常数。ts

plugin.tx_yourextension_key {   
    settings {
        enableWebsiteField = {$plugin.tx_extension_key.settings.enableWebsiteField}
}
 plugin.tx_yourextension_key {  
       settings {
        enableWebsiteField = 1
 }
您可以像这样在
controller.php
文件中获取值

$this->settings['enableWebsiteField']

非常感谢,我会试试的。就是这样!非常感谢。